Output 6682df2134e3665eb6553545869b75150f21337557ad0d9f87daaf6807391def:1

value
376456
script pubkey
OP_0 OP_PUSHBYTES_20 39c26efb439eb67a54cfedada3f9a50fc3b9aab2
address
bc1q88pxa76rn6m854x0akk687d9plpmn24j52g8w3
transaction
6682df2134e3665eb6553545869b75150f21337557ad0d9f87daaf6807391def
confirmations
176318
spent
true